Located in the southern reaches of Odisha, Balimila (also known as Balimela) is a town defined by its relationship with water and power. It serves as the site for one of the state's most important hydroelectric projects, creating a vast and picturesque reservoir. The area is characterized by rugged terrain and dense greenery, offering a glimpse into the rural beauty of the Malkangiri district. While primarily an industrial and residential hub for dam workers, it attracts visitors looking for serene vistas and a quiet escape from the more crowded tourist circuits of India. The surrounding hills provide a dramatic backdrop to the engineering marvel of the dam.

Before you go: Balimila essentials

  • Remote location with limited luxury accommodation options.

  • Proximity to the Balimela Reservoir and hydroelectric power station.

  • Ideal for travelers seeking a quiet, non-commercialized experience.

  • Limited English speakers; knowing basic Odia or Hindi is helpful for local interaction.

Transport

Public transport to Balimila can be limited; hiring a private vehicle from Jeypore or Malkangiri is recommended for flexibility.

Photography

The reservoir offers stunning views at sunrise and sunset, making it a great spot for landscape photography.

Best For

Nature lovers and those interested in industrial engineering.

Local Customs

Respect local traditions and seek permission before photographing sensitive industrial areas or local residents.

Connectivity

Mobile network coverage may be spotty in certain remote areas around the dam and reservoir.

Best time to visit Balimila

October-March

Spring

Pleasant weather makes it a good time for outdoor exploration and viewing the reservoir.

Summer

Temperatures can be quite high; it is best to stay hydrated and avoid midday sun.

Best Season

Fall

Post-monsoon, the landscape is exceptionally green and the reservoir is full, offering the best views.

Winter

The most comfortable time to visit, with cool temperatures ideal for sightseeing and travel.
